Injection molding machine industry digital design platform

Date:2013/12/24 9:53:00

Large injection molding machine industry cluster -based industries in the private enterprises as the mainstay , has formed a large-scale production capacity. Currently, the domestic injection molding machine manufacturing capability of independent development is relatively backward , design capability, manufacturing technology and equipment level is relatively low, the products mainly middle and low , resulting in poor international competitiveness, low-profit situation. Therefore , an urgent need to improve the injection molding machine industry core technology competitiveness of enterprises , in order to stimulate the sustainable development of the whole industry chain and related industries through technological progress . The authors suggest a key technology research design, manufacturing and related technical achievements in one of the injection molding machine digital product design and development platform to provide the necessary technical foundation to enhance the core competitiveness of the overall injection molding machine industry.
